The intense desert sun and frequent dust storms in Mesa, Arizona, can really take a toll on your sliding glass doors. Heat can warp frames, and fine sand can grind down rollers and tracks, making them hard to open and close. These conditions often lead to doors that stick, jam, or even come off their tracks. You might notice the glass becoming cloudy due to extreme temperature changes, or the seals around the glass starting to break down. The cost to repair these issues in Mesa can vary. Simple cleaning and lubrication are less expensive than replacing worn-out rollers or fixing a damaged track. The type of door and its age also play a part in the repair process. When you call for a repair, the final bill depends on a few specific variables. We look at the condition of the track, the type of rollers needed, and whether the door panel itself needs adjustment or alignment. If the locking mechanism or handle assembly requires a full replacement rather than a simple tune-up, that will naturally increase the labor and parts involved. Sliding door locks in Mesa are often fixed by adjusting the mechanism, cleaning debris, or replacing worn-out parts. Sometimes, the lock might be misaligned with the strike plate on the frame. If the lock is broken, a replacement is usually necessary. The pros will diagnose the exact issue. Ensuring your door is secure is our priority.
In Mesa, patio door locks can get stiff or stop working correctly due to dust and sand accumulation. Extreme heat can also affect the internal components, causing them to seize up. A common problem is a lock that's hard to turn or doesn't fully engage. We can help get your patio door locks functioning reliably again.
